The local community is the primary place of belonging for the Daughters of Charity.
Community living fosters among them a sharing that extends not only to material conditions
but also to spiritual and apostolic commitments.
In dialogue experiences are shared, differences are minimized
and decisions are sought together
.

Constitutions of the Daughters of Charity


The Daughters of Charity who form the local community in Wilmington, DE support each other by their life together to continue a long tradition of service in Wilmington which has reshaped itself many times to meet changing needs. Sisters Barbara Ann and Donna administer St. Peter’s School. Sr. Edith works in St. Peter’s Adult Center, Sr. Margaret Mary provides outreach services through the Seton Center and Sr. DeSales assists at St. Peter’s Rectory.
